首页 >> 宝藏问答 >

excel表格怎么排序名次

2025-08-26 22:19:20

问题描述:

excel表格怎么排序名次,求路过的高手停一停,帮个忙!

最佳答案

推荐答案

2025-08-26 22:19:20

excel表格怎么排序名次】在日常工作中,Excel 是我们处理数据的重要工具。对于一些需要按成绩、排名等进行排序的数据表,掌握如何快速排序名次是非常有必要的。本文将详细讲解如何在 Excel 中对数据进行排序,并生成对应的名次。

一、基本排序方法

1. 选中数据区域

点击要排序的数据区域,或直接点击任意一个单元格(Excel 会自动识别整个数据区域)。

2. 打开排序功能

在菜单栏中选择“数据”选项卡 → 点击“排序”。

3. 设置排序条件

在弹出的对话框中,选择要排序的列(如“分数”),并选择升序或降序排列。

4. 确认排序

点击“确定”,Excel 会按照设定的条件对数据进行排序。

二、生成名次的技巧

如果你希望根据排序后的结果自动生成名次,可以使用公式实现。

方法一:使用 `RANK` 函数

假设你的分数在 B 列(B2:B10),你可以在 C 列输入以下公式:

```excel

=RANK(B2, $B$2:$B$10)

```

然后向下填充公式,即可得到每个分数对应的名次。

方法二:使用 `SORT` 和 `SEQUENCE`(适用于 Excel 365 或 2021 版本)

如果你使用的是较新的 Excel 版本,可以使用以下公式来生成排序后的名次:

```excel

=SORT(B2:B10, 1, -1)

```

再配合 `SEQUENCE` 函数生成名次列:

```excel

=SEQUENCE(COUNTA(B2:B10))

```

三、示例表格

姓名 分数 名次
张三 90 2
李四 85 3
王五 95 1
赵六 80 4
小明 92 2

> 注:此处名次为示例,实际名次需根据数据动态计算。

四、注意事项

- 如果有重复分数,`RANK` 函数会给出相同的名次。

- 使用 `RANK.EQ` 或 `RANK.AVG` 可以更灵活地处理重复值。

- 排序后建议保存原数据备份,避免误操作导致数据丢失。

通过以上方法,你可以轻松地在 Excel 中对数据进行排序并生成相应的名次。掌握这些技巧,能大大提高你的工作效率和数据处理能力。

  免责声明:本答案或内容为用户上传,不代表本网观点。其原创性以及文中陈述文字和内容未经本站证实,对本文以及其中全部或者部分内容、文字的真实性、完整性、及时性本站不作任何保证或承诺,请读者仅作参考,并请自行核实相关内容。 如遇侵权请及时联系本站删除。

 
分享:
最新文章